UFC fighters Ian Garry and Khamzat Chimaev nearly came to blows in an elevator during UFC 273 Fight Week.
Ian Garry and Khamzat Chimaev are two potential future UFC champions. One is ranked number 10 at welterweight (Garry), the other number 9 at middleweight (Chimaev). Furthermore, Ian Garry has indicated that he would like to face Khamzat Chimaev in the future.
In an interview with “MMA On Point”, Ian Garry recounted his meeting with Khamzat Chimaev. The two athletes fought at UFC 273, in April 2022, and therefore crossed paths during Fight Week. According to the 26-year-old Irishman, things almost turned sour…
Khamzat Chimaev vs. Ian Garry
“I’ll tell you a funny story about Khamzat. We got in the elevator, my wife and I are there, we press the button, the doors open, Khamzat and his wife get in… I would love to have a fight here. I would have liked to fight Khamzat in the middle of an elevator. The story would have been fucking cool. »
Ian Garry continued: “My wife looks at me with her eyes bulging and says, ‘Do it, fight him’. In my head, I tell myself that my teammates are going to fight him tomorrow. I’m not going to spoil this. There are two women here. He and I will die if we fight in an elevator. We get out of the elevator and my wife looks at me and says, ‘You’re a bitch.’ »
Fortunately, Ian Garry and Khamzat Chimaev did not come to blows. A fight between these two monsters in such a small space could have had devastating effects. The one we nickname ‘The Future’ will have the opportunity to let off some steam on December 16, during UFC 296. Indeed, he will face the number 8 in his division, Vicente Luque. Sean Strickland sounds off on Ian Garry
Sean Strickland recently sounded off on Ian Garry after the welterweight contender took offense to comments Strickland made about his relationship with his wife after fans brought up a book she wrote over a decade ago.
The reigning UFC middleweight champion took to his Instagram account, where he posted a video blasting ‘The Future’ for threatening to take legal action against him, saying:
“You think I give a f**k about that [being sued]? You want me to respect you. You say that, ‘I’m gonna go to Bass Pro Shop…I’m gonna go buy a 9, I’m gonna handle this like a man’, I would have respected that. I don’t fu****g respect that.”
